新聞中心
MySQL指令: UNLOCK TABLES(解鎖表)
在MySQL數(shù)據(jù)庫中,當我們使用LOCK TABLES指令鎖定表時,為了保證數(shù)據(jù)的完整性和一致性,我們需要使用UNLOCK TABLES指令來解鎖表。

發(fā)展壯大離不開廣大客戶長期以來的信賴與支持,我們將始終秉承“誠信為本、服務至上”的服務理念,堅持“二合一”的優(yōu)良服務模式,真誠服務每家企業(yè),認真做好每個細節(jié),不斷完善自我,成就企業(yè),實現(xiàn)共贏。行業(yè)涉及成都圍欄護欄等,在網(wǎng)站建設、成都營銷網(wǎng)站建設、WAP手機網(wǎng)站、VI設計、軟件開發(fā)等項目上具有豐富的設計經(jīng)驗。
UNLOCK TABLES的語法
UNLOCK TABLES的語法如下:
UNLOCK TABLES;
這個指令非常簡單,只需要使用UNLOCK TABLES即可。
UNLOCK TABLES的作用
當我們使用LOCK TABLES指令鎖定表時,其他用戶將無法對被鎖定的表進行讀寫操作。這在某些情況下是非常有用的,比如在進行數(shù)據(jù)備份或者數(shù)據(jù)恢復時。
然而,一旦我們完成了需要鎖定表的操作,就需要使用UNLOCK TABLES指令來解鎖表,以便其他用戶可以繼續(xù)對表進行操作。
UNLOCK TABLES的注意事項
在使用UNLOCK TABLES指令時,需要注意以下幾點:
- 只有鎖定表的用戶才能解鎖表。如果你嘗試解鎖一個沒有被鎖定的表,將會收到一個錯誤提示。
- 如果你在鎖定表之前使用了FLUSH TABLES指令,那么在解鎖表之后,你需要使用FLUSH TABLES指令來刷新表緩存。
UNLOCK TABLES的示例
下面是一個使用LOCK TABLES和UNLOCK TABLES指令的示例:
LOCK TABLES mytable WRITE;
-- 執(zhí)行一些需要鎖定表的操作
UNLOCK TABLES;
在這個示例中,我們首先使用LOCK TABLES指令鎖定了一個名為mytable的表,并執(zhí)行了一些需要鎖定表的操作。然后,我們使用UNLOCK TABLES指令解鎖了這個表。
總結(jié)
在MySQL數(shù)據(jù)庫中,使用LOCK TABLES指令鎖定表是一種保證數(shù)據(jù)完整性和一致性的方法。然而,為了讓其他用戶可以繼續(xù)對表進行操作,我們需要使用UNLOCK TABLES指令來解鎖表。
如果你想了解更多關(guān)于MySQL指令的信息,可以訪問我們的官網(wǎng):https://www.xwcx.net。我們提供香港服務器、美國服務器和云服務器等產(chǎn)品,香港服務器選擇創(chuàng)新互聯(lián),我們還提供10元香港服務器和香港服務器免費試用。
網(wǎng)站名稱:MySQL指令:UNLOCKTABLES(解鎖表)
標題URL:http://m.5511xx.com/article/dpihoho.html


咨詢
建站咨詢
